When administering cyclosporine, the nurse notes that allopurinol is also ordered for the patient. What is a potential result of this drug interaction?
 
  a. Reduced adverse effects of the cyclosporine
  b. Increased levels of cyclosporine and toxicity
  c. Reduced uric acid levels
  d. Reduced nephrotoxic effects of cyclosporine

Immunoglobulin injections may give short-term protection against, or reduce severity of certain diseases. They help people who have an inherited problem making their own antibodies, or those who are having certain types of cancer treatments.

When intravenous medications are involved in adverse drug events, their harmful effects may occur more rapidly, and be more severe than errors with oral medications. This is due to the direct administration into the bloodstream.
